Trouble Following Storylines & Hard to Adjust to Change

Trouble following storylines may happen because of early Alzheimer’s. This is an exemplary early indication. Similarly as finding and utilizing the correct words gets troublesome, individuals with Alzheimer’s fail to remember the implications or meanings of words they hear or battle to track with discussions or TV programs.

For somebody in the beginning phases of Alzheimer’s, the experience can cause dread. Abruptly, they can’t recollect individuals they know or follow what others are saying. They can’t recollect why they went to the store, and they get lost on their way to work, school or home.

Along these lines, they may want to stick to their normal routine and be reluctant to attempt new encounters. Trouble adjusting to change is likewise common and a symptom of early Alzheimer’s.
